Triple Threat
(Image credit: Netflix)
(Image credit: Netflix)
The script isn’t as good as the stellar cast, which includes Tony Jaa, Scott Adkins and Iko Uwais, but the action scenes are absolutely ferocious and the review describing it as a “high octane extravaganza” nailed the appeal. It’s not the kind of film that’ll have you stroking your chin in contemplation: it’s the kind of film where a whole bunch of absolutely incredible martial artists knock lumps out of bad guys in increasingly dramatic and thrilling ways. The story makes very little sense but this film is all about the action, which it delivers in ever more exciting and eye-popping set-pieces.
Kung Fu Hustle
(Image credit: Netflix)
(Image credit: Netflix)
If you’ve ever wished somebody would mash up martial arts movies and Looney Tunes cartoons, you’re going to love this. Kung Fu Hustle is about two hopeless would-be gangsters who pretend to be part of the dreaded Axe Gang – only for the Axe Gang to turn up to restore their tarnished reputation. Luckily for our heroes, three legendary kung fu masters live in the area and aren’t happy to see the Axe Gang throwing their weight around. It is very violent, very silly and very, very funny, and Stephen Chow’s direction keeps the gags and the punches flowing fast.
